"This Must Be the Place" is a phrase that has become a cornerstone of modern culture, appearing as a timeless anthem by Talking Heads, a surreal road-trip film, and an award-winning novel. While each medium tells a different story, they all share a common thread: the search for belonging and the complex meaning of "home."
